Oi kyries tis avlis (Greek: Οι κυρίες της αυλής/ English: Ladies of the Courtyard) is a 1966 Greek film based on the theatrical play To ekto patoma (Το έκτο πάτωμα = The Next Step).
It was made into a movie following the success of the play with Dinos Iliopoulos in 1964 and 1965 at the Gloria Theatre.
The film was directed by Dinos Dimopoulos, a student of Iliopoulos at the Dramatic school.
Dinos Iliopoulis was rewarded 90,000 drachmas for his role, a high fee at the time.
